What is a mini PC?

A mini PC, sometimes known as a small form factor (SFF) PC, comes with almost all the same hardware that a laptop or desktop computer has but with a smaller footprint. Granted, mini PCs are not as fast as larger computers, but they have a processor, RAM, storage, and ports for connecting peripherals like monitors, keyboards, and mice. They can run operating systems like Windows, ChromeOS, or Linux and can handle basic web browsing, productivity apps, and multimedia playback.

Depending on the specs and configuration, a Mini PC is usually around the same size and shape as a hardcover book. Some are optimized for lots of onboard storage, some for faster processors, and some for specific use cases, like powering tradeshow kiosks, security systems, or digital signage screens.

Since there’s no universal standard for mini PC specs, it isn’t easy to establish a narrow price range. Asus’s Chromebox 5, for example, has variants ranging from $299 to $980, all with the same size dimensions.

Generally, we recommend looking for a mini PC from a reputable manufacturer with at least 8GB of RAM, 128GB of storage, and a VESA mount. Some of our favorites include MSI’s PRO DP21 or their Cubi 5, Apple’s Mac Mini, and Asus’s ExpertCenter PN64 or Chromebox 5. What is a PC stick?

A PC stick, also known as a computer stick, is like a mini PC that’s been shrunk down to the size of an oversized USB flash drive. Stick PCs have a processor, RAM, and storage, but one thing that sets them apart from mini PCs is that instead of connecting to a screen or monitor via HDMI cable, stick computers have an HDMI output attached flush against the body of the device.

While they tend to look almost identical to Amazon’s Fire TV Stick, PC sticks are around 3-4x larger and often come with slots for USB, microSD, ethernet, and other inputs. Their processors are almost always less powerful than a mini PC but sometimes come with as much as 8GB of RAM and 256GB of storage.

It’s getting harder to find a PC on a stick than a few years ago. In 2015, we got both Intel’s incredible Compute Stick and Asus’s Google Chromebit. Unfortunately, both had short runs, with no ongoing software support or follow-up generations. Today, your PC stick options are limited to MeLE’s Fanless PC Stick, Azulle’s Access4, or, when speed isn’t essential, the AIOEXPC PC Stick, with prices ranging from $130 to $310.

Like all hardware purchases, beware of anything that doesn’t have at least 100 reviews or sufficient documentation. Too-good-to-be-true deals from unknown dealers come with malware and extremely unreliable performance.

How to know if you need a mini PC or a PC stick

Depending on your use case, you’ll likely want to prioritize one of three hardware variables: processor speed, RAM, or onboard storage. Plenty of other minor differences affect how and where these types of devices work best, but for most people, they’re too in the weeds.

If you’ll need your computer to handle a lot of user input (e.g. editing images or PowerPoint presentations) or multitasking, processing power will be priority number one, go with a mini PC. 

Lots of RAM has benefits similar to those of a faster processor. But it can also play a significant role when running a standalone, mostly passive app that renders a lot of data (e.g., dashboards, data visualizations, etc.). For use cases when your PC needs to access and manipulate large datasets, go with a mini PC with 16GB of RAM.

On the other hand, if you’re looking for more of a basic media player (e.g., digital signage or an advertising screen), try to estimate how much storage space your content will take up and go with a PC stick if the total is 128GB or less.

Digital signage screens powered by mini PCs and PC stick

Remotely pushing employee and customer engagement messages to screens is one of the most effective uses of small form factor computers. The best digital signage devices have a low profile and rarely require significant processing power, RAM, or storage. Sub-$50 streaming sticks can get the job done but have a low ceiling for capacity, compatibility, and customizability. A full-blown PC running a familiar operating system opens up all kinds of options.

If information-sharing is your primary goal, a PC stick would be more than enough to power a simple slide that consolidates notifications from several team apps or combines separate calendars into a single source of truth.

Upgrade your setup to a mini PC, and you could create more powerful, professional signage, like a screen that moderates user-generated content or a dashboard with an independent zone for showing upcoming office or clinic visitors. And when you want to push more to your screen than the hardware can handle, you can always turn a mini PC into a thin client that merely “streams” content handled by another computer in the cloud or on your local network.
